Environmental stress as an indicator of anthropogenic impact across the African Albertine Rift: a case study using museum specimens

2014-08-01

Abstract excerpt

We examined fluctuating asymmetry (FA) and body condition (BC) as two measures of environmental stress using museum specimens of Lophuromys aquilus, a rodent species complex wide-spread across the African Albertine Rift. We related FA and BC to a spatially-derived index of anthropogenic impact using a principal components analysis (PCA).
